JJeffGCIf you are looking for a Maldivian getaway that balances island relaxation with a bit of ”city” energy and variety, SAii Lagoon is a fantastic choice. Unlike the more isolated private islands, this resort is part of the CROSSROADS Maldives project, which means you aren't just limited to one resort’s dining and activities.
🚤 Location & Arrival
One of the biggest perks is the 15-minute speedboat ride from Velana International Airport. After a long flight, being at the resort and checked in within 30 minutes is a luxury in itself. No waiting hours for a seaplane!
🛌 The Room Experience
The design here is very ”Boho-Chic”—bright, colorful, and modern.
• Sky Rooms: Great value with a beautiful balcony view of the lagoon.
• Beach Villas: The direct beach access is worth the upgrade. The ”creature comfort” pillows and the ability to customize your own bathroom amenities at the Aroma Bar were unique touches that made the stay feel personalized.
🍴 Dining & Activities
This is where SAii really stands out. Because it’s connected by a footbridge to The Marina @ CROSSROADS and the Hard Rock Hotel:
• Variety: You have access to over 10+ dining options. We loved Miss Olive Oyl for Mediterranean flavors, but having the option to walk over to the Hard Rock Café or the Ministry of Crab at the Marina kept things exciting.
• The Hub: The Marina has a discovery center, shops, and a beach club (Café del Mar style).
• Snorkeling: The house reef is decent, and we spotted plenty of colorful fish and even a few small reef sharks near the overwater walkways.
💡 Pro-Tips for Travelers:
1. Download the App: Use the SAii App to request buggies or book dinner tables—it’s much faster than calling the front desk.
2. Explore the Marina: Don't just stay on the SAii island. The sunset views from the Marina pier are some of the best on the island.
3. Hilton Honors: If you have status, the perks here (like breakfast or room upgrades) are well-recognized as it’s part of the Curio Collection.
Summary: Perfect for couples or families who want a vibrant, social atmosphere rather than total isolation. The proximity to Malé makes it the ultimate stress-free Maldivian escape!
Would I return? Absolutely, especially for a shorter trip where I want to maximize my time on the sand rather than in transit.

AAnonymous UserThe hotel has a perfect location, the best on the island: it is in 10 meters only from the beautiful main entry to the bikini beach. The beach is so big and clean! Umbrellas are for an additional fee but there's no need in them cause you can sit wherever you want under the tree.
I had a cosy room with a balcony, on the second floor. In the room, you have everything you need: an air conditioner, a kettle, a fridge, lots of lights, towels etc. Cleaning is upon request. Wifi was good.
The staff is extremely friendly and polite, always ready to help, they helped me so many times with different questions, the kindest people!!
A team of divers live at the hotel and leads excursions for guests from the whole island. Snorkeling with them was the best experience in my life! I've seen colorful fish, big sharks, dolphins, and even a sea turtle.
For breakfast, you have a choice between continental and maldivian breakfasts, I personally loved the last one, it was delicious. Always fresh fruits and juice before breakfast.
Sometimes in the evening, the hotel prepares barbecue dinner with fresh fish from the sea and with traditional music, such an authentic experience!
There are several restaurants on the island to have dinner, including the hotel restaurant. They're more or less of the same quality and price, liked local food there.
Gulhi is very calm and tiny island, just 30 min on the boat from Male island. (The transfer to Gulhi from the airport costs $25.) There were not many tourists on the island, when I stayed. No noise at night at all, so if you're looking for calmness, this is probably the better choice for you than Maafushi. Also it feels safe if you're a female solo traveler.
For me, everything was just perfect, loved the place, the food, the beach, the excursions. I think the guesthouse is the best price/quality option on the island.
